Output 23416d636cd97139c75d91f209c49b399d66a6fcff0e80d61c3677864916969f:0

value
12299600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e10bbf64e5ff43b8b38c5365db52a6dc58fec27e OP_EQUALVERIFY OP_CHECKSIG
address
1MWw7QJP5P9tS9taA1TPbqjjXHT24eV3gJ
transaction
23416d636cd97139c75d91f209c49b399d66a6fcff0e80d61c3677864916969f
spent
true